The Juniper Networks vMX (Virtual MX Series) is a full-featured, carrier-grade virtual router. It mirrors the functionality of physical MX Series 3D Universal Edge Routers. Running on x86 servers, it allows network professionals to run the Junos OS inside a virtualized environment without the need for expensive, power-consuming physical hardware. Decoding the Filename
